Transaction ed2a0afc078da6f5fc4ecd4b7109e792b58aaf0bf6552a3025e4239af8241d9a

5 Input
1 Outputs
  • ed2a0afc078da6f5fc4ecd4b7109e792b58aaf0bf6552a3025e4239af8241d9a:0
  • value  774984
    address  3F99W6YA5MVgXASPBTBGpEHu2GzsydPhky